与孩子分开dom元素

时间:2015-10-14 04:15:06

标签: javascript jquery html css

我正在创建一个根据用户条目动态生成文档的Web应用程序,用户可以在表单旁边看到他的文档预览(每次用户回答问题时都会更新预览)。但我现在遇到麻烦,试图找出一种方法,从丑陋的弹出窗口转换为真实的PDF,如预览,用户可以在其中看到他的文档与输出(pdf)相同的外观。

我尝试了很多方法,例如检查哪个子元素溢出并将它(它旁边的元素)移动到下一个元素,但是如果子元素太大,那么我将在第一页上有两行,一半在另一个等...

我已经考虑过从弹出窗口创建一个画布(截图),但应用程序将非常贪婪地使用浏览器的资源并且会杀死应用程序的性能。

最好的方法是什么?

在jquery中有没有办法分割它:

<span>
  <span>
    <span>
      Lorem impus
    </span>
  </span>
</span>

到此

<span>
  <span>
    <span>
      Lorem
    </span>
  </span>
</span>
<span>
  <span>
    <span>
      impus
    </span>
  </span>
</span>

但是很快就没有影响应用程序的性能?

0 个答案:

没有答案